East Carolina Head Coach Jeff Lebo
"We just got whipped. There is no way around sugar coating it. Physically we were not even in the area code tonight. We had match up problems obviously tonight. Rebounding issues, we knew we were going to have those. We've manage to hide them a little bit at times in games this year, but we're awfully small at the forward position with Kemp and Sampson. We had match up issues with Sykes, who just scored scored on us at will. Rompza is terrific, he makes them a different team now that he is back. He controlled the game I thought for 40 minutes. To me he was the best player on the court. He's a leader, and he made shots tonight."
On UCF's interior defense
"We got our shots blocked a lot. We got a lot deflected or block inside and early that intimidated us. They are big and athletic and we got in there at times in the first half, but just could not finish."
On UCF's run to start the second half
"We have trouble at times scoring. We put our best scorers on the court and they are 6'2, 6'2, 6'1 out there and can't get a rebound. We just were not good offensively for the majority of the time I didn't think. We had a couple looks that needed to go down but couldn't make them. We struggled the whole night offensively and all that had to do with their size and their length bothered us."
UCF Acting Coach Shawn Finney
"Just looking at the game tonight you got a great team effort on our part when you look at the guys who played well for us. Keith Clanton and Isaiah Sykes. Those guys came in and really gave us a big lift tonight. I've got to give our team credit. East Carolina kept punching us, they kept trying to make those quick runs on us and our guys played with a lot of poise. They really stayed focused down the stretch and I thought East Carolina, when they got us under pressure, was going to cause us some problems. But our guys handled it and were able to finish the game. I thought that was key on the way the game went down but you have to give A.J. Rompza some credit for running our show. He really got us into our offense, set the tone defensively, shared the ball as well as scored and I thought he was a big key to our victory tonight."
On UCF's post play
"When you come into the game obviously your concerned about Morrow and how the way he can score down low. When he gets deep post up he can really score the ball, but we did a good job of limiting his touches down low, not letting him get as many deep post ups. We also wanted to try to get the ball inside and try to make them guard us in the post and try to create some opportunities where they may foul us and get in foul trouble down low as well."
On the play of Keith Clanton
"Keith Clanton's versatility is a big key to his game. He can score inside, outside, he's got the mid-range game, he can put it on the floor and that makes him a tough guard for someone else. Keith is one of the guys that we want to go to whether that is shoot a three or post up, and with his versatility we want to create miss matches with his perimeter game."
ECU Senior Darrius Morrow
"Central Florida is a good team. They are big; the zone they play is tough. I think we just had a tough night. Nights like this happen and we are just looking forward to next Saturday."
On ECU's poor shooting performance
"It just happens. We had been shooting the ball pretty well lately. I guess we were due for an off night, but we are not going to hang our heads. We are looking forward to our next game and next couple of practices. We have a lot of practices until the next game and we are just going to shake back after this loss."
ECU Junior Miguel Paul
"We had a bad shooting night. I don't think they out-muscled us or anything like that. They played hard and got a lot of the 50-50 balls that we didn't get, including some rebounds that we let stick around that we could have grabbed. We got the shots that we wanted; we just didn't knock most of them down."
